Ingredients List

  • 4 chicken breasts: I recommend using boneless, skinless chicken breasts for easy prep and tender results. If you can, choose organic for the best flavor!
  • 4 medium potatoes, diced: Go for russet or Yukon gold potatoes. Just make sure to peel and dice them into about 1-inch pieces so they cook evenly.
  • 2 cups green beans, trimmed: Fresh green beans are the way to go! Just snap off the ends and give them a rinse. You can also use frozen green beans if you’re in a pinch, but fresh adds such a nice crunch!
  • 1 cup Italian dressing: This is where the magic happens! A good quality Italian dressing brings all those zesty flavors to life. You can even make your own if you’re feeling adventurous!
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der: A must for that aromatic punch! If you love garlic like I do, feel free to sprinkle a little extra.
  • Salt and pepper to taste: Don’t skip this! A pinch of salt and a dash of pepper elevate the flavors beautifully. Just taste as you go to find that perfect balance.

How to Prepare *Italian Chicken Potato and Green Bean Bake*

Alright, let’s get cooking! Preparing this *italian chicken potato and green bean bake* is straightforward, and I’ll guide you through each step so you can nail it every time.

Preheat the Oven

First things first, pre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C). Preheating is super important because it helps ensure that everything cooks evenly and gets that delicious golden brown color. Give it about 10-15 minutes to reach the right temperature while you prep the rest of your ingredients.

Prepare the Vegetables

Next up, let’s get those veggies ready! Start by dicing your potatoes into about 1-inch pieces—this way, they’ll cook perfectly alongside the chicken. If you’re using Yukon gold or russet potatoes, peel them first! Then, grab your fresh green beans, trim off the ends, and give them a good rinse. If you want to save time, frozen green beans work too, but fresh ones provide that lovely crunch!

Assemble the Dish

Now for the fun part! In a large baking dish, combine the diced potatoes and green beans, spreading them out evenly. Place the chicken breasts right on top of the veggies—this allows the juices to seep down and flavor everything beautifully. Drizzle that zesty Italian dressing over the chicken and veggies, and don’t forget to sprinkle the garlic powder, salt, and pepper on top. Yum!

Baking Process

Pop the dish into the oven and let it bake for about 45 minutes. To check if the chicken is done, use a meat thermometer; it should read 165°F (75°C) when fully cooked. If your chicken breasts are particularly thick, you may need to adjust the cooking time a bit. Just keep an eye on it, and you’ll be golden!

Tips for Success

Alright, let’s talk about how to take your *italian chicken potato and green bean bake* to the next level! Trust me, these little pro tips will make a big difference in your final dish.

  • Mix up the vegetables: Don’t hesitate to get creative! You can add bell peppers, zucchini, or even cherry tomatoes for a pop of color and flavor. Just make sure to adjust cooking times if you choose vegetables that cook faster!
  • Marinate for more flavor: If you have a bit of extra time, marinate the chicken in the Italian dressing for a few hours or even overnight. It really amps up the flavor and makes the chicken super juicy!
  • Use a meat thermometer: For perfectly cooked chicken, invest in a meat thermometer. It takes the guessing out of cooking and ensures your chicken is tender and safe to eat every time.
  • Layer wisely: When layering your veggies, place the potatoes on the bottom since they take a little longer to cook than the green beans. This lets everything cook evenly and keeps those beans nice and crisp!
  • Don’t rush the rest: If you find yourself with extra time while the bake is in the oven, take a moment to prep a simple side salad or some crusty bread. It pairs beautifully with the main dish and rounds out your meal perfectly!
  • Leftover magic: If you have leftovers, don’t just reheat them as is! Toss them into a wrap or salad for a quick and tasty lunch the next day. It’s like getting a new meal out of the same dish!

Storage & Reheating Instructions

So, you’ve made this delicious *italian chicken potato and green bean bake* and now you have some leftovers—lucky you! Here’s how to store and reheat it so it retains that wonderful flavor.

To store, let the bake cool down to room temperature, then transfer it to an airtight container. It can stay in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. Just make sure it’s sealed well to keep those tasty flavors locked in!

When you’re ready to enjoy those leftovers, pre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Place the bake in an oven-safe dish, cover it with foil to prevent it from drying out, and heat for about 20–25 minutes or until warmed through. If you prefer, you can also reheat individual portions in the microwave—just pop them in for 1-2 minutes, stirring halfway through to get that even warmth.

FAQ Section

Can I use other vegetables?

Absolutely! One of the best things about the *italian chicken potato and green bean bake* is its versatility. Feel free to throw in other vegetables like bell peppers, zucchini, or even carrots. Just keep in mind that cooking times may vary, so add quicker-cooking veggies towards the last 15 minutes of baking to keep them crisp and vibrant!

How long will leftovers last?

Leftovers are a wonderful perk of this dish! If stored properly in an airtight container, your *italian chicken potato and green bean bake* can last in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. Just make sure to cool it to room temperature before sealing it up to keep those flavors fresh!

Can I make this dish ahead of time?

You sure can! To prep ahead, you can assemble everything in the baking dish and cover it tightly with plastic wrap or foil. Just pop it in the fridge and bake it when you’re ready—don’t forget to add an extra 10-15 minutes to the baking time if it’s coming straight from the fridge. It’s a great way to save time on busy nights!

Is this dish gluten-free?

Yes, this *italian chicken potato and green bean bake* is naturally gluten-free! Just make sure to check the label of your Italian dressing to ensure it’s gluten-free as well, as some store-bought versions might contain gluten. If you want to make your own dressing, that’s a fantastic way to control the ingredients and flavors!
